這一題用double是不是有點浪費呢
?for(j=0;j<=i;j++)
? ? ? ? {
? ? ? ? ? ? if(arr[j]>arr[j+1]) ? ? ?//當(dāng)前面的數(shù)比后面的數(shù)大時
? ? ? ? ? ? {
? ? ? ? ? ? ? ? float temp; ? ?//定義臨時變量temp
? ? ? ? ? ? ? ? temp=arr[j]; ? ? //將前面的數(shù)賦值給temp
? ? ? ? ? ? ? ? arr[j]=arr[j+1]; ? ? ? ? ? ? ?//前后之?dāng)?shù)顛倒位置
? ? ? ? ? ? ? ? arr[j+1]=temp; ? ? ? ? ? ? ?//將較大的數(shù)放在后面 ? ?
? ? ? ? ? ? } ? ? ? ? ? ? ? ??
? ? ? ? } ? ? ? ? ? ? ? ?
? ? }
我最后用了float
2018-09-27
fdxgfdhtfhfdb
2015-04-01
我記得有個老師講過 ?現(xiàn)在的計算機(jī)的cpu性能都比較高 就算你用了字節(jié)小的float ?在計算機(jī)計算的時候 占用空間還是按 double的位數(shù)算 ?除非特別特別專業(yè)的人 好像都不用太考慮這個問題?? 不知道我說的對嗎....
2015-03-12
在這個例子中無所謂。
其實在目前通常的環(huán)境中,建議浮點型優(yōu)先使用double。雖然很多人覺得double要占用更多的位,但實際上float的精度常常無法滿足要求。一個int型變量甚至可能無法無損地賦值給一個float類型。
2015-03-12
這個只是個demo,你可以使用其他的類型,只是精度不同